Research Assistant, Community Accountability For Police Violence

Winnipeg, MB, CA, Canada

Job Description

This posting will be used to hire 2 positions



Research Assistants are normally students, in a University of Winnipeg undergraduate program, employed to assist with tasks related to research. Work is performed within defined guidelines and under supervision of a more senior researcher or faculty member.


Position Overview:





This position will involve connecting with community partners, helping to organize a community-based research event, conducting literature reviews, and report-writing.


Duties:




Prepare Equipment and Materials for Research + help to organize community-based research gathering for stakeholders involved in advocating for victims of police violence
Assist with duties related to the production of articles, publications, reports and presentations + assist in report writing and writing public-facing materials related to police accountability processes
Prepare literature review + related to trauma-informed research about police and other forms of state-violence
Assist in data collection, data entry, analysis and interpretation + help to collate and organize existing qualitative data about community policing, community-based alternatives to policing, and community-based police accountability mechanisms
Perform routine clerical and administrative duties to support research activities + collect and submit receipts and fill out paperwork related to administering the research grant

Qualifications:




Some university preferred, or other demonstration of capacity to conduct literature reviews of academic literature. Experience with and community connections in the area of police accountability in Winnipeg preferred. Some knowledge of existing police accountability mechanisms in Winnipeg preferred.
